#1fcd12 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1fcd12 is composed of 12.2% red, 80.4% green and 7.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 84.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 91.2% yellow and 19.6% black. It has a hue angle of 115.8 degrees, a saturation of 83.9% and a lightness of 43.7%. #1fcd12 color hex could be obtained by blending #3eff24 with #009b00. Closest websafe color is: #33cc00.

#1fcd12 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1fcd12 has RGB values of R:31, G:205, B:18 and CMYK values of C:0.85, M:0, Y:0.91, K:0.2. Its decimal value is 2084114.
